What an Investor Needs First

Articul8 AI is a full-stack generative AI platform for regulated industries, focusing on domain-specific models operating on proprietary data. The company spun out from Intel in early 2024 [Intel Newsroom, 2024], with its platform reportedly in production for over two years, achieving 93% accuracy in root cause analysis [YouTube/AI Field Day 7].

Founder and CEO Dr. Arun Subramaniyan holds a PhD in engineering simulation and led digital twin development at GE Research [Times of India]. The platform differentiates through its proprietary ModelMesh reasoning engine and a security-first architecture supporting on-premise, air-gapped, or hybrid deployments [Perplexity Sonar].

Articul8 raised $35 million in a Series B round led by Adara Ventures in January 2026, following a seed round from DigitalBridge Ventures [GlobeNewswire, Jan 2026]. Its SaaS model is distributed through AWS, Microsoft Azure, and Google Cloud.

Inside the Company

Articul8 AI launched in early 2024 as a standalone enterprise from Intel, with DigitalBridge Ventures as a founding investor [Intel Newsroom, 2024]. The company is headquartered in Santa Clara, California [Crunchbase]. The seed round was announced in January 2024 [Finsmes/Tracxn, 2024]. In January 2026, the company secured a $35 million Series B led by Adara Ventures, reportedly propelling its valuation past $500 million [GlobeNewswire, Jan 2026]. The company lists on major cloud marketplaces including AWS, Microsoft Azure, Google Cloud, and Databricks [Perplexity Sonar].

Under the Hood

Articul8 AI’s platform is engineered for high-stakes data environments in regulated industries, processing machine logs, sensor telemetry, and CAD drawings within strict security perimeters [Intel Newsroom, 2024].

The platform features domain-specific models (DSMs) and a proprietary reasoning engine called ModelMesh [Perplexity Sonar]. The semiconductor-focused A8-Semicon model reportedly shows twice the performance of open models like DeepSeek-R1 in code debugging and root cause analysis [Fierce Sensors]. Industrial application accuracy is reported at 88-93% for equipment failure detection [AWS Startups] and 93% for semiconductor fab root cause analysis [YouTube/AI Field Day 7]. The stack integrates specialized Llama models from Meta and optimizes for infrastructure across AWS SageMaker HyperPod, Intel Xeon/Gaudi, Microsoft Azure, Google Cloud, and Databricks [AWS Startups].

Competition and Substitutes

Articul8 AI integrates domain-specific models and proprietary reasoning engines into industrial data environments [Perplexity Sonar].

  • Incumbent enterprise AI platforms: C3.ai and Palantir Foundry.
  • Hyperscaler-native AI services: AWS SageMaker, Google Vertex AI, and Microsoft Azure AI [AWS Startups].
  • Open-source and general-purpose model providers: Meta [AWS Startups].
  • Industrial software incumbents: Siemens, Rockwell Automation, and PTC.
